Why you keep releasing CSS using so many duplicated color declaring methods?
--bs-body-color: #212529; --bs-body-color-rgb: 33, 37, 41;You can easily replace all these using this and preserve all functionality as it is, this is a super quick fix.
color: color-mix(in srgb, var(--bs-link-color) calc(var(--bs-link-opacity, 1) * 100%), transparent);Even better would be a unified color + alpha or something
--bs-body-color: #212529FF;Or, nice to have a true, separate pallete.css having all color definitions.
